The Dallas Mavericks hoped for a deep playoff run when they acquired Kyrie Irving. Since he joined the team, the Mavs are on the edge of not making the postseason.

The Dallas Mavericks made a blockbuster deal at the trade deadline by acquiringThe Mavs are 8-12 since they acquired the eight-time All-Star, and when he's on the floor, they are 6-8. The Mavs were 29-26 before the trade.Kyrie Irving of the Dallas Mavericks walks up the court during the first half against the Charlotte Hornets at American Airlines Center March 24, 2023, in Dallas, Texas.

Irving has been with his new team about six weeks, and he cites the recent struggles to adjusting to new teammates. "And we're still feeling each other out in a way of getting used to each other's efforts and attitudes and temperament," Irving said."And that's a real thing. That's a human thing. That's a human element. Whether people believe it in basketball or not, there's a very fine line between winning basketball games and everyone being on the same page and losing basketball games and things splintering and pointing fingers.
